Jim Tressel may wind up staying employed by the Colts. He just won’t be taking over for Jim Caldwell.
Mike Freeman of CBSSports.com has a Colts source that says there is “no way in hell” Tressel will get the top job. Still ,owner Jim Irsay reportedly likes Tressel and may want to keep him in some capacity.
We’re not sure what capacity exactly that would be. Surely, the next Colts head coach would have something to say about it.
ESPN’s Chris Mortensen has floated Marc Trestman as a possible candidate in Indianapolis. Steve Spagnuolo met with the team about the defensive coordinator position before Caldwell was fired.
Otherwise, the Colts have done a good job keeping their head coaching search a mystery so far.
